Output 593bc0deeedf7c1450227966da7bcb73b2d731cdecf4f42d1377ef1c2c33bb47:5

value
44250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66265262cd0cefe7d35ad170057a2784d9e0bc05 OP_EQUAL
address
3B18kksTZ3VDiuft2wMu6k15v2Mu8HZ4gX
transaction
593bc0deeedf7c1450227966da7bcb73b2d731cdecf4f42d1377ef1c2c33bb47
confirmations
320957
spent
true